Webb27 dec. 2024 · In your Teardrop options window, make sure the "Adjust teardrop size" checkbox is checked and that "Force teardrops" is unchecked. If you have "Force teardrops" checked then it will create the teardrop regions regardless of what's around it, and will ignore the clearance rules. Webb10 dec. 2024 · PCB teardrops are your insurance policy against drill wander and layer misalignment during fabrication. If misalignment is severe, there is still a high chance the drill hit will not sever the connection between the pad and via. As you can see … prime rib bone in or notWebb18 aug. 2024 · The importance of using teardrop increases as the traces become narrow. Teardrop rings are not necessary for conductors bigger than 20 mils. Also, teardrops are recommended for flex PCBs because of its structural integrity against shear and vibration.
